    This Is HISTORY | Birthdays

    May 25 1048

    Emperor Shenzong of China 6th emperor of the Song dynasty in China born in Kaifeng China (d. 1085)

    May 25 1334

    Emperor Suk Japanese Emperor of the Northern Court (1348-51) (d. 1398)

    May 25 1458

    Mahmud Begada Sultan of Gujarat (successfully captured Pavagadh and Junagadh forts in battles ) born in Ahmedabad India (d. 1511)

    May 25 1729

    Jean de Neufville Dutch-American merchant (started 4th English war) born in Amsterdam (d. 1796)

    May 25 1494

    Jacopo da Pontormo [Carucci] Italian painter (Sepulture of Christ) born in Pontormo Italy (d. 1557)

    May 25 1550

    Camillus de Lellis Italian Roman Catholic saint (founder of the Ministers of the Sick) born in Bucchianico Kingdom of Naples (d. 1614)

    May 25 1606

    Charles Garnier French Jesuit missionary in New France born in Paris (d. 1649)

    May 25 1661

    Claude Buffier French philosopher and historian born in Warsaw Poland (d. 1737)

    May 25 1688

    Christian August Jacobi German composer born in Grimma Leipzig (d. 1725)

    May 25 1713

    John Stuart 3rd earl of Bute Prime Minister of Great Britain (1760-63) born in Parliament Square Edinburgh Midlothian (d. 1792)

    May 25 1725

    Samuel Ward American politician (31st and 33rd Governor of the Colony of Rhode Island and Providence Plantations) born in Newport Rhode Island (d. 1776)

    May 25 1726

    Giuseppi Paolucci Italian composer born in Siena Italy (d. 1776)

    May 25 1767

    Friedrich Johann Eck German violinist and composer (Concertos pour violon) born in Mannheim Germany (d. 1838)

    May 25 1779

    Hendrik Marcus de Kock Dutch general and politician (Lieutenant Governor-General of the Dutch East Indies 1826-30) born in Heusden Dutch Republic (d. 1845)

    May 25 1781

    Ferdinand Karl Joseph Archduke of Austria-Este born in Milan (d. 1850)

    May 25 1783

    Philip Pendleton Barbour American politician and U.S. Supreme Court justice born in Gordonsville Virginia (d. 1841)

    May 25 1818

    Jacob Burckhardt Swiss cultural historian born in Basel Switzerland (d. 1897)

    May 25 1821

    Diederich Krug German pianist and composer (Le petit Chevalier) born in Hamburg Germany (d. )

    May 25 1830

    Jules de Geyter Belgian poet (International) born in Lede Belgium (d. 1905)

    May 25 1839

    John Eliot English meteorologist born in Lamesley Durham (d. 1908)

    May 25 1845

    Lip Pike American baseball player born in NYC New York (d. 1883)

    May 25 1846

    Princess Helena of the United Kingdom daughter of Queen Victoria born in Buckingham Palace London (d. 1923)

    May 25 1846

    Naim Frashri Albanian poet and writer born in Frashr Janina Vilayet Ottoman Empire(d. 1900)

    May 25 1847

    Alphonse Goovaerts Belgian composer and musicologist (Histoire et Bibliographie de la Typographie Musicale dans les Pays-Bas) born in Antwerp Belgian (d. 1922)

    May 25 1847

    John Alexander Dowie Scottish-American evangelist (founded the city of Zion Illinois) born in Edinburgh Scotland (d. 1907)

    May 25 1852

    William Muldoon American wrestler and owner of NY health institute The Olympia born in Caneadea Allegany County New York (d. 1933)

    May 25 1856

    Louis Franchet dEsprey French general during WWI born in Mostaganem French Algeria (d. 1942)

    May 25 1860

    James McKeen Cattell American psychologist born in Easton Pennsylvania (d. 1944)

    May 25 1865

    Frederick Augustus III King of Saxony (1904-18) born in Dresden Germany (d. 1932)

    May 25 1865

    John Mott American evangelist and organizer (YMCA Nobel 1946) born in Livingston Manor Sullivan County New York (d. 1955)

    May 25 1865

    Pieter Zeeman Dutch physicist (Zeeman effect Nobel Prize 1902) born in Zonnemaire Schouwen-Duiveland (d. 1943)

    May 25 1877

    Billy Murray American singer (Denver Nightengale) born in Philadelphia Pennsylvania (d. 1954)

    May 25 1879

    William Maxwell Aitken Lord Beaverbrook Canadian English newspaper publisher (Daily Express) born in Maple Ontario (d. 1964)
